Multidimensional Culturalism: Where culture is created
Some cities claim diversity. LA lives it. It’s not just a melting pot; it’s an ever-evolving fusion where ideas from across the globe collide, merge, and transform into something new.
The cross-pollination of cultures isn’t just seen—it’s heard in the Spanglish hooks of a chart-topping hit, felt in the West Coast basslines that shaped hip-hop, and read between the poetic, rebellious verses of a street-born anthem. LA doesn’t just celebrate cultural fusion; it lives it.
But this city doesn’t just embrace cultural creation; it is LA’s biggest export. The movements that take shape in LA don’t stay in LA; they ripple outward, shaping global music trends, reimagining street fashion, redefining contemporary art, and influencing how the world eats, speaks, and creates.
West Coast hip-hop didn’t just change music—it reshaped language, style, and culture. Chicano streetwear, born from LA’s fusion of Mexican-American and skate culture, now influences high fashion runways globally. The city’s food scene, shaped by its immigrant communities, gave birth to the gourmet food truck revolution, trends in Wellness-Driven Cuisine, and the infamous $20 celebrity collab smoothies that have redefined food trends worldwide.
And it’s not just about heritage; it’s about curiosity. LA is where the boundaries between influences blur, and entirely new creative genres are born. In LA, artistry isn’t about staying in one lane; it’s about merging, remixing, and pushing beyond the known.

And that climate flows through the many neighborhoods that make up LA. Los Angeles is not one city; it’s many cities and neighborhoods layered within each other, each with their own unique ethos, personality, and creative pulse.
A friend once told me, "If you don't like LA, you haven't explored enough." There is something here for everyone! And the best part? You don't have to choose. LA is a place you discover, piece by piece, one neighborhood at a time. It’s a place that encourages you to explore and embrace your own multidimensionality.
But it’s not just the people, cultures, and physical environment that make LA a creative force; it’s the uniqueness of its many spaces. Each neighborhood hums with its unique vibe, an ecosystem of creativity shaped by its history, energy, and artistic pulse.
LA’s architectural cacophony tells a story on every block. Spanish Revival homes neighbor sleek Mid-Century Modern designs, and Craftsman bungalows contrast with gravity-defying stilt houses perched above the hills. This layered, ever-shifting cityscape isn’t just a backdrop; it actively fuels creativity.
The diversity of neighborhoods, each with its own personality and rhythm, creates endless inspiration. The unexpected collisions of style, form, and culture make for the most beautiful juxtapositions, keeping your imagination on its toes.
In LA, inspiration doesn’t follow a straight line; it thrives in the contrast, the remix, and the spaces where seemingly opposing elements meet to spark something entirely new.
